问题描述
我正在寻找达到图表最小值的方法。
我找到并尝试了 options.scales.yAxes[n].ticks.beginAtZero = true
,但 0 太小,不能成为图表的最小值。
有没有办法在对象(或使用方法)中设置图表的最小值?
解决方法
从您的示例 options
来看,您似乎使用的是 Chart.js v2,而不是标签 chart.js3 建议的 v3。
因此,您可以使用 options.scales.yAxes[n].ticks.min
来自Chart.js v2.9.4 documentation:
min
:用户定义的比例最小值,覆盖数据中的最小值。
Chart.js v3 也可以通过定义 options.scales.y.min
来实现同样的效果,如 here 所述。